Khusela Diko slams Malatsi's SABC bill withdrawal as 'trigger-happy' and 'ill-advised' The bill, which was tabled by Malatsi's predecessor, Mondli Gungubele, sought to address funding issues and governance reforms at the public broadcaster. Malatsi, however, argued that the bill fell short in addressing the SABC’s financial model and gave too much power to the minister in appointing board members. Diko, however, warned that the withdrawal could severely disrupt necessary reforms and further jeopardize the future of the SABC.
